Django AllAuth是一个功能强大的Django插件,可用于实现社交用户系统。它提供了一种简单而灵活的方式,让我们能够轻松地将第三方登录(如Google、Facebook、Twitter等)集成到我们的Django应用程序中。在本文中,我们将介绍如何安装和配置Django AllAuth,并提供相应的源代码示例。
- 安装Django AllAuth
首先,我们需要安装Django AllAuth。使用以下命令可以通过pip安装:
pip install django-allauth
- 配置Django AllAuth
安装完成后,我们需要对Django进行配置以使用Django AllAuth。打开Django项目的settings.py
文件,并进行以下设置:
INSTALLED_APPS = [
# 其他应用程序
'django.contrib.sites'